Rick Curry Sr Celebration of Life: Sept. 24

­
­
­

IAM previously reported on the passing of Rick Curry. His celebration of life will happen on Sept. 24.

 

Rick Curry passed away suddenly on June 18. He was a former IAM Chairman and is the current Chairman of the IAM Ethics Council and the Co-Chair of the IAM Looking Back project. He is also a member of IAM’s Hall of Honor, and served for many years on the Hall of Honor Selection Committee.

 

Rick was widely known and loved in the industry, and was very active in IAM. He devoted a great deal of time, care and wisdom to the association, and will be sorely missed by all who knew him.

Lithium Battery Webcast Summary

­

On 25 August, IAM hosted a webcast discussion on the potential for federal shippers (DoD, GSA, DoS) to create policy requiring the shipping/storing of used lithium batteries (and the products that use them), within a customer’s personal property shipment. Watch the recording now.

 

IAM hosted Pete Kramer from the Department of Transportation’s Transportation Safety Institute, to discuss the requirements for shipping lithium batteries with compliance with dangerous goods regulations. Pete has extensive experience with the requirements to transport dangerous goods, specifically lithium batteries. And the challenges and requirements to do it within a personal property shipment domestically, and internationally.
